The Benefits of Using Straight Razor Blades
Understanding the advantages of straight razor blades can elevate your shaving experience while also improving your grooming routine. Here's an insightful breakdown:
1. Precision: Straight razor blades allow for a closer shave by enabling you to adjust the angle easily, resulting in fewer missed spots and a smoother finish.
2. Cost-Effective: While the initial investment may be higher, straight razors only require periodic honing and stropping, eliminating the continuous purchase of disposable cartridges.
3. Eco-Friendly: Choosing straight razor blades can significantly reduce plastic waste when compared to disposable razors, making it a sustainable grooming option.
4. Skin Benefits: Many users report fewer irritations and razor bumps, as straight blades glide smoothly over the skin without pulling or tugging.
5. Traditional Art: Using a straight razor transforms shaving into a respected ritual, allowing users to appreciate the craftsmanship behind these vintage tools.
6. Customization: Many enthusiasts enjoy personalizing their razor experience through different blades and honing techniques, making each shave a unique affair.
